We had to register just to give a review of this campground! We are active duty family campers (two kids - ages 7 and 4) and we really pleased with this campground. We only live about 45 minutes away and thought it would be great for the 4th weekend. There is a easy walk short walk to the beach and when VA Beach was completely overcrowded and no parking, we had our own little oasis! There were not too many people, for a beach, and we were actually able to see the nearby fireworks from the beach by the campground!! It was great to have no beach traffic!! We were in the newer section "Northend", (Northend and Southend are right by each other) and this section does not have any trees, the "Southend" did. We were right by the brand new bath house which was super clean. In the women's there were only 3 shower stalls, one was wheel chair accessible and was missing its shower curtain, which would have been very frustrating if I would have needed to use that one. Also, I don't know about the Southend, but our section did not have any grills at the campsite (we have our own, but they do have a common picnic area with grills) and there are no fire rings. Sites are a little close together, but we thought it was great, we loved being so close to the beach and it fit our needs perfectly. We didn't have cable, but we could pick up the major channels by antenna. I don't consider us people who need to be on a computer all the time, but the major negative was no WiFi. If you are going to be there long term, that could be an issue. Overall, we highly recommend this campground if you are looking to just relax and head to the beach. Close to the Oceana Commissary and Exchange, Mini Mart right nearby. Will be back!
